JavaWeb中验证码的实现 在Web程序中,验证码是经常使用的技术之一。Web程序永远面临未知用户和未知程序的探测。为了防止恶意脚本的执行,验证码技术无疑是首选方案之一。本文将讨论如何在JSP和Servlet中使用验证码技术。
kaptcha 是一个扩展自 simplecaptcha 的验证码库. 项目主页: http://www.open-open.com/lib/view/home/1324535442327
验证码识别涉及很多方面的内容。入手难度大,但是入手后,可拓展性又非常广泛,可玩性极强,成就感也很足。 验证码图像处理 验证码图像识别技术主要是操作图片内的像素点,通过对图片的像素点进行一系列的操作
over the 应该说准确率还令人满意吧. pytesser 的验证码识别能力比较低,只能对规规矩矩不歪不斜数字和字母验证码进行识别,这里还是要介绍下它的用法。有关它的安装和python对应的模块可以参考
patchca 是一个简单但功能强大的验证码的Java类库。 项目主页: http://www.open-open.com/lib/view/home/1324535468936
iCaptcha 是一个 Java 的验证码库,支持国际化和可定制。 示例代码: //Optional Properties Properties props = new Properties();
用HttpClient模拟客户端浏览器注册发帖。但是碰到了图形验证码的问题了,对单数字的验证码,通过一些OCR引擎,如:tesseract,AspriseOCR很容易解决问题。但碰到如CSDN论坛这中图形验证码就比较麻烦,必须先通过预处理。使图象二值化,黑白灰度,增加亮度。
public class ValidationCode { // 图形验证码的字符集合,系统将随机从这个字符串中选择一些字符作为验证码 private static String codeChars =
VerifyCodeImgHelper() { // // TODO: 在此处添加构造函数逻辑 // } #region 验证码长度(默认4个验证码的长度) int length = 4; public int Length { get
jsp验证码代码 在开发中验证码是比较常用到有效防止这种问题对某一个特定注册用户用特定程序破解方式进行不断的登陆尝试的方式。 此演示程序包括三个文件: 1.login.jsp:登录页面 2.code
2、验证码设计程序 package com.libo; import java.awt.Color; import java.awt.Font; import java.awt.Graphics;
<?php class Page { private $total; //总记录 private $pagesize; //每页显示多少条 private $limit; //limit private $page; //当前页码 private $pagenum; //总页码 private $url; //地址 private $bothnum; //两边保持数字分页的量 //构造方法初始化
Decaptcha 自动工具能以25%的成功率破解维基百科的 Captcha 验证码,15个最流行网站有13个存在类似的弱点。Visa 的验证码破解成功率高达66%,eBay 为43%。Google 和 reCAPTCHA
web实现图形验证码功能
(1)kaptcha 是一个验证码生成工具。你可以生成各种样式的验证码,因为它是可配置的。kaptcha工作的原理是调 com.google.code.kaptcha.servlet.KaptchaS
一套用于生成各种图形验证码的库(Java),底下是一些生成验证码的例子: Image generated with the fiveletterFirstName generator. Image generated
MotionCAPTCHA是一个 jQuery 的验证码 CAPTCHA 插件,要求用户按照图中指示画出大概的形状。基于 HTML5 的 Canvas 技术实现。 在线演示 项目主页:
Cage是一个用于生成验证码图的Java类库。它具有快速、小型和简单的特点。其目的是生成,易于人读取的图像,但对一台计算机不可能或至少是非常困难的读取。 特性 it is open source, Apache
一款适用于并发高并且易于集成的验证码服务 功能简单介绍下: 1. 随机生成算术题,并随机将题目中的部分数字/运算符变成汉字 2. 每个文字随机颜色、字体倾斜度 3. 初始化生成 100 张验证码,运行过程中循环取图片,如果每
在应用程序注册、登陆或者有关支付确认的界面,经常会用到验证码,验证码有的是通过手机发送获取的,有的是在本地点击获取的,通过手机发送获取的动态验证码可以使用第三方类库实现,本地点击获取的是在本地自己绘制